Your printer is equipped with internal sponges designed to catch excess ink during head cleanings. Over time, a built-in counter reaches its limit to prevent ink from leaking out of the machine. When this happens, you will see: A "Service Required" message on your computer. Alternating flashing lights on the printer panel. A complete halt in all printing and scanning functions.
